Outdoor Research Women's Ferrosi Joggers

About This Item

Fit & Design

  • Harness compatible waist
  • Faux Fly
  • Drop in mesh hand pockets
  • Back right security zip pocket
  • Gusseted crotch
  • Articulated knees
  • Tapered calf with internal elastic at ankles
  • Movement mirroring stretch

Additional Details

  • Lightweight durability, weather resistance, UPF 50+ protection
  • Quick drying breathable finish made from bluesign® approved 46% recycled nylon highlight the characteristics of ferrosi fabric
  • Internal logo elastic waist with exterior drawcord

Thin And Durable

I gave these pants about 6 months before I wrote a review. Yes, the material is thin and you can see lines and such, but very stretchy and durable. I’ve gone on several backpacking trips and they’ve survived tree snags, devils club, tree pitch being removed with alcohol, washing frequently, etc. I wanted something with a slightly more slim fit than regular hiking pants and these are perfect. I’ve got longer legs and they’re great, but if you’re below 5’9” these might be a tad long. Overall they’ve earned a 5 star rating from me.

This Fabric Is Not Durable

I wanted to love these. I love the fit and feel of these joggers. However, the fabric is not durable at all. I've worn them only two times and as another reviewer noted, they pill badly. On the first wear I only wore them casually and I noticed some pilling on the thighs. The next time I wore them on a short hike with my dog and there was a bad area of pilling extending from the seam by my left pocket out onto the top of my bum. I'm not even sure what would have rubbed there. They are now essentially ruined as they look too awful to wear casually now and will continue to get worse if I use them in situations that is hard on the pants.
